99问答网
所有问题
当前搜索:
分布式唯一id生成策略
Vitess 全局
唯一 ID 生成
的实现方案 | 京东云技术团队
答:
然而,CAS虽然降低了锁表带来的影响,但同时也引入了一定的并发竞争和重试问题。通过调整缓存大小,可以有效地平衡性能和并发控制。总的来说,Vitess的全局
唯一ID生成策略
在保证高效的同时,兼顾了数据一致性,是京东云技术团队在
分布式
数据库管理中的一项重要创新。
如何在高并发
分布式
系统中
生成
全局
唯一Id
答:
1) 使用自增序列号表 专门一个数据库,
生成
序列号。开启事物,每次操作插入时,先将数据插入到序列表并返回自增序列号用于做为
唯一Id
进行业务数据插入。注意:需要定期清理序列表的数据以保证获取序列号的效率;插入序列表记录时要开启事物。使用此方案的问题是:每次的查询序列号是一个性能损耗;如果...
如何在高并发
分布式
系统中
生成
全局
唯一Id
答:
可以用现有的支持原子操作的
分布式
数据库,例:Redis 很多网站用Redis 的原子性来
生成唯一
标识符 我们可以用本机的Mac地址,硬盘序列号,本地最大标识符来拼接出唯一。Mac 可被修改,硬盘序列号也有可能不唯一,但是这三样拼接在一起,碰撞的概率很小的 Md5 也会碰撞,不是么?
雪花算法之【线上订单号重复了?一招搞定它!】
答:
先上code 以上是采用snowflake算法
生成分布式唯一ID
41-bit的时间可以表示 (1L<<41)/(1000L360024*365)=69 年的时间,10-bit机器可以分别表示1024台机器。如果我们对IDC划分有需求,还可以将10-bit分5-bit给IDC,分5-bit给工作机器。这样就可以表示32个IDC,每个IDC下可以有32台机器,可以根据自...
分布式ID生成
器(CosId)的设计与实现
答:
分布式ID生成
器CosId:创新设计与卓越性能 CosId,作为一款高性能的分布式ID生成器,其核心组件包括SnowflakeId、SegmentId、IdSegmentDistributor和SegmentChainId,旨在满足业务扩展中对全局
唯一
性、有序性和高吞吐量的严苛需求。面对复杂的分布式场景,CosId以其稳定的0.208us/op的P9999性能,展现出卓越...
Redis-全局
唯一ID
答:
1、全局唯一ID特点 2、全局
唯一ID生成策略
1、snowflake算法全局唯一ID策略 此处我们参考 snowflake算法的
ID策略
,其具体策略如下:① 1位,固定位; ② 41位,用来记录时间戳(毫秒),接近69年; ③ 10位,用来记录工作机器id; ④ 12位,序列号,用来记录同毫秒内产生的不同id;2、...
flake是什么意思啊?
答:
"flake"是指一种
分布式ID生成
器,可以生成全局
唯一
且有序的ID。它具有以下特点:每个ID包括时间戳、机器标识和序列号;机器标识和序列号最多可以支持4096台机器并发
生成ID
;时间戳保证了ID的有序性,且可以使用时间戳逆向推导出生成ID的时间。因此,flake在分布式系统中广泛应用于数据一致性、...
分布式ID生成
器
答:
在
分布式
系统中,往往需要对大量的数据和消息进行唯一标识,此时一个能够
生成
全局
唯一ID
的系统是非常必要的,那么业务系统对ID号的要求有哪些呢?UUID UUID(Universally Unique Identifier)的标准型式包含32个16进制数字,以连字号分为五段,形式为8-4-4-4-12的36个字符,示例:5e8c4456-6166-40d6-9b9...
如何保证数据库集群中
id
的
唯一
性,假设每秒钟并发20万次
答:
用雪花算法的工具类,1秒内可以
生成
26万不重复的值,数据库的主键不要自增,手动设置 package entity;import java.lang.management.ManagementFactory;import java.net.InetAddress;import java.net.NetworkInterface;/** * 名称:IdWorker.java * 描述:
分布式
自增长
ID
* * Twitter的 Snowflake JAVA实现...
id
前端
生成
还是后端
答:
前端
生成ID
的常见方法有:使用浏览器提供的时间戳、随机数、UUID算法等。这种方式对于需要频繁生成ID的场景比较合适,例如大量并发用户注册、
生成唯一
订单号等。在后端生成ID的优势是可以确保ID的唯一性和安全性。后端生成ID可以使用数据库自增ID、
分布式ID生成
算法等。这种方式适用于对
ID唯一
性有严格要求的...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
唯一id生成算法
短的分布式id
数据库如何实现唯一昵称
分布式生成唯一id的生成方式
全局唯一id生成策略
分布式全局id生成方案
分布式id生成
redis生成全局唯一id
redis生成唯一id